Android 2.3 Gingerbread Ported to iPhone 3G The Android 2.3 platform introduces many new and exciting features for users and developers. Unfortunately, with a little effort, hackers made tremendous progress to bring the Android 2.3 Gingerbread to the iPhone 3G. iPhone 3G is the first device on which Android 2.3 has been installed successfully using the same OpeniBoot software in previous ports. The OpeniBoot is an open source software based on iBoot that allows jail breakers to insert their own code such as Linux kernel into iPhone and iPod touch. Video demonstration
Android 2.3 Gingerbread on HTC Desire By surprising the users of HTC Desire, an XDA user and Android hacker AdamG had successfully ported Android 2.3 Gingerbread to HTC Desire. This achievement is made by porting a Gingerbread ROM using the system.img and ramdisk.img from the Google SDK. Video demonstration
